A gigabit wireless router is an electronic networking device that routes computer network signals appropriately to ensure smooth functioning of the network. This wireless device essentially performs all the same functions as a wired router, but it provides additional wireless points of access to enable access to a computer network or the Internet without any need for wired connectivity here are the findings.

Gigabit wireless routers can operate in wired LAN, wireless LAN as well as combined wired and wireless LAN environments.

Netgear N600 Wireless Gigabit Router

WNDR3700, the wireless dual band router from Netgear is a great networking device for homes as well as small businesses. It includes a high powered 680 MHz processor to ensure top speed performance, USB storage access, dual band wireless, four super-fast gigabit Ethernet ports, Video QoS, guest networking and professional wireless security.

The device includes eight high-sensitivity antennas to serve each band exclusively and power amplification that ensures optimal wireless range for the network. The router performs on 2.4 GHz and 5.0 GHz frequencies at the same time.

D-Link Xtreme N Gigabit Router

DIR-655 router from D-Link uses the highly advanced Draft 802.11n wireless technology. This enables the router to operate at ultra-fast speeds and enhances it range capabilities. It provides extra security for the network and is ideal for mixed mode local area networks.

For users who make an extensive use of multi-media devices, the DIR-655 is an excellent choice because of its Multiple Input Multiple Output (MIMO) technology. The Intelligent Quality of Service (QoS) of the model enables the user to prioritize specific data such as gaming, sound or media streaming over other types of data. This customization capability ensures that you get the best speeds and best performance for the particular functions that you need frequently.

Belkin N1 Vision Wireless Router

As the name suggests, the N1 Vision enables the user to view the computer network’s bandwidth usage, broadband speed and the LAN status with the help of its interactive status display. The key features of N1 Vision include the 802.11 wireless capability, wired gigabit ports and 3×3 radio design.

The model is perfect for home computer networks. The installation is simple for even a novice who does not even need to run an installation CD. The model includes four Gigabit Ports for effective connectivity.
